body, footer {
  font-family: Verdana, Geneva, Tahoma, sans-serif;
}

.logo {
  background-color: black;
  padding-right: 35%;
  padding-left: 35%;
  width: 30%;
  height: auto;
}

footer {
  background-color: rgb(0, 56, 184);
  padding-top: 10px;
  padding-bottom: 10px;
  text-align: center;
  color: white;
}

.slogan {
  text-align: center;
  background-color: rgb(0, 56, 184);
  color: white;
  padding-top: 10px;
  padding-bottom: 10px;
}


img {
  border-radius: 20px;
  width: 100%;
}

/* cars for sale on homepage css */
.row {
  box-sizing: border-box;
}

.column {
  float: left;
  width: 30%;
  height: auto;
  padding: 10px;
  margin: .5%;
  border: 2px solid gray;
  border-radius: 20px;
}

.row::after {
  content: "";
  clear: both;
  display: table;
}

body a {
  color: black;
}

footer a {
  color: rgb(239, 239, 239);
}

.column:active {
  background-color: rgb(200, 200, 200);
}

a:link {
  text-decoration: none;
}

a:active {
  color: black;
}

.ComingSoon {
  width: 100%;
  height: auto;
}

/* Social Media */

#socials {
  text-align: center;
  
  padding-top: 10px;
  padding-bottom: 10px;
}

#insta {
  display: flex;
  justify-content: center;
}




@media screen and (max-width: 1100px) {
  .column {
    width: 45%;
    height: auto;
    padding: 10px;
    margin-left: 1.4%;
    margin-bottom: 1.4%;
  }
  .logo {
    width: 45%;
    height: auto;
    padding-right: 27.5%;
    padding-left: 27.5%;
  }
}


@media screen and (max-width: 800px) {
  .column {
    width: 90%;
    height: auto;
    padding: 10px;
    margin-left: 3%;
    margin-right: 3%;
  }
  .logo {
    width: 60%;
    height: auto;
    padding-right: 20%;
    padding-left: 20%;
  }
}


